Which is zero of the polynomial expression 7x+21

The expression will have a zero when it’s equation is equal to zero:

7x+21=0

Now solve for x, start by isolating the variable (x) by subtracting 21 from both sides

7x = -21

The only thing stopping c from being by itself is 7, so we divide both sides by 7 to isolate x

x = -3
